Why Most Brand Strategies Fall Short Many businesses treat marketing and PR as separate boxes to check. Marketing runs ads. PR sends press releases. Neither team knows what the other is doing. The result? Mixed messages. Wasted budget. A brand that feels inconsistent to the people you most want to impress. The fix is not complicated. It starts with alignment.
